Kaieteur News – Chief Education Officer (CEO), Suddam Hussain revealed on Tuesday that Guyana has seen a decline in performance in Mathematics and English at the Caribbean Secondary Education Certificate (CSEC) level in 2024. Hussain made the announcements at the release of the 2024 CAPE and CSEC results held at the Queen’s College Auditorium. In […]
